Python 基础
近视未看清
这个作者很懒,什么都没留下…
展开
-
暴力破解WiFi密码
需要手动安装pywifi库(直接pip install pywifi的方法不行),手动安装方法自行百度。import itertools as itsimport pywififrom pywifi import constimport timeimport datetime# 测试连接,返回链接结果,pwd为密码,wifi_name为要破解的WiFi名称def wifiConnect(pwd, wifi_name): # 抓取网卡接口 wifi = pywifi.PyWi原创 2021-03-10 13:40:24 · 4278 阅读 · 0 评论 -
数据合并
题目描述将两个从小到大排列的一维数组 (维长分别为 m,n,其中 m,n≤100) 仍按从小到大的排列顺序合并到一个新的一维数组中,输出新的数组.输入描述第 1 行一个正整数 m , 表示第一个要合并的一维数组中的元素个数第 2 行一个正整数 n , 表示第二个要合并的一维数组中的元素个数第 3 行输入 m 个整数 (每个数用空格分开) , 表示第一个数组元素的值.第 4 行输入 n 个整数 (每个数用空格分开) , 表示第二个数组元素的值.输出描述一行,表示合并后的数据,共 m+n个数样原创 2021-01-07 13:17:29 · 230 阅读 · 0 评论 -
多组数据的最大公约数
题目描述给定 2个数,a和 b (3<a,b≤10000),求出 a和 b的最大公约数。输入描述多组输入,输入的第一行为一个正整数 n,表示接下来有 n 组数据,每一行为两个正整数 a,b (3<a,b≤10000)。输出描述对于每一组数据,求出 a 和 b 的最大公约数。样例输入22 43 5样例输出21def gcd(a,b):#递归求两个数的最大公约数 if b==0: return a return gcd(b,a%b)n=原创 2021-01-07 12:14:07 · 724 阅读 · 1 评论 -
Python-字典应用
问题描述 给定当前的时间,请用英文的读法将它读出来。 时间用时h和分m表示,在英文的读法中,读一个时间的方法是: 如果m为0,则将时读出来,然后加上“o’clock”,如3:00读作“three o’clock”。 如果m不为0,则将时读出来,然后将分读出来,如5:30读作“five thirty”。 时和分的读法使用的是英文数字的读法,其中0~20读作: 0:zero, ...原创 2020-04-14 22:59:56 · 177 阅读 · 0 评论 -
Python-特殊回文数字
问题描述 123321是一个非常特殊的数,它从左边读和从右边读是一样的。 输入一个正整数n, 编程求所有这样的五位和六位十进制数,满足各位数字之和等于n 。输入格式 输入一行,包含一个正整数n。输出格式 按从小到大的顺序输出满足条件的整数,每个整数占一行。样例输入52样例输出899998989989998899数据规模和约定 1<=n<=54。代...原创 2020-04-14 22:58:03 · 551 阅读 · 0 评论 -
Python-数列排序
问题描述 给定一个长度为n的数列,将这个数列按从小到大的顺序排列。1<=n<=200输入格式 第一行为一个整数n。 第二行包含n个整数,为待排序的数,每个整数的绝对值小于10000。输出格式 输出一行,按从小到大的顺序输出排序后的数列。样例输入58 3 6 4 9样例输出3 4 6 8 9代码实现:n = int(input())li = list(...原创 2020-04-14 22:55:03 · 1717 阅读 · 0 评论 -
Python- 切片操作
问题描述利用字母可以组成一些美丽的图形,下面给出了一个例子:ABCDEFGBABCDEFCBABCDEDCBABCDEDCBABC这是一个5行7列的图形,请找出这个图形的规律,并输出一个n行m列的图形。输入格式输入一行,包含两个整数n和m,分别表示你要输出的图形的行数的列数。输出格式输出n行,每个m个字符,为你的图形。样例输入5 7样例输出ABCDEFGBABCDE...原创 2020-04-14 22:52:04 · 2090 阅读 · 0 评论 -
Python-列表转字符串
问题描述对于长度为5位的一个01串,每一位都可能是0或1,一共有32种可能。它们的前几个是:0000000001000100001100100请按从小到大的顺序输出这32种01串。输入格式本试题没有输入。输出格式输出32行,按从小到大的顺序每行一个长度为5的01串。样例输出00000000010001000011<以下部分省略>代码实现:for i...原创 2020-04-14 22:46:58 · 223 阅读 · 0 评论 -
python生成词云图
python生成词语图需要使用python的第三方类库jieba、matplotlib、wordcloud,如果没有请用pip安装。import jiebaimport matplotlib.pyplot as plt #相当于c的宏定义from wordcloud import WordCloud,STOPWORDStext=""f=open(r"File\word_clo...原创 2020-04-14 13:33:36 · 197 阅读 · 0 评论 -
Python -使用国内镜像的pip安装
对于Python开发用户来讲,PIP安装软件包是家常便饭。但国外的源下载速度实在太慢,浪费时间。而且经常出现下载后安装出错问题。所以把PIP安装源替换成国内镜像,可以大幅提升下载速度,还可以提高安装成功率。国内源:新版ubuntu要求使用https源,要注意。清华:https://pypi.tuna.tsinghua.edu.cn/simple阿里云:http://mirrors.aliy...原创 2020-04-14 19:04:29 · 126 阅读 · 0 评论